      Ok, open your installed KingdomColor.xml file with a text editor and check a "<PlayerClanBannerFollowsKingdom>" tag. It must be set as "false" like so:

      <PlayerClanBannerFollowsKingdom>false</PlayerClanBannerFollowsKingdom>

      If it already set as 'false', the problem probably comes from another mod that override this variable and i can't do anything against.
